Hostinger vs Cleura: Kubernetes Cost Comparison (2026)

Hostinger is 79% cheaper than Cleura for a 3-node Kubernetes cluster (€48 vs €233/mo)

Hostinger costs 79% less — a saving of ~€185/mo on a standard 3-node cluster. Cleura handles control plane operations; with Hostinger you self-host the control plane, trading simplicity for flexibility. Choose Hostinger for cost-efficient Kubernetes on a budget; choose Cleura for a fully managed control plane with less operational overhead.
